First, adjust the tightness of the handbrake.
In winter, the road surface is slippery, and the hand brake has more functions. Need to adjust the tightness, be sure to pull when parking to ensure that the car does not slip.
Second, check the tires and air pressure.
In winter, the road friction coefficient is low, so the tire pressure should not be too high, but it should not be too low. The outside temperature is low and the tire pressure is low. Soft tires will seriously accelerate aging. In addition, due to the characteristics of automobile positioning, such as a certain camber angle, high in the middle of the road and low on both sides, the internal and external wear of tires is quite different. In order to ensure safety and reduce wear and tear, tires should be replaced regularly.
Third, the battery should be replenished with electrolyte.
The battery is most afraid of low temperature, and the capacity of the battery under low temperature environment is much lower than that under normal temperature. Therefore, before the arrival of the cold season, the electrolyte of the battery should be replenished, and the terminals of the battery should be cleaned and protected with special grease to ensure reliable starting and prolong the life of the battery. If the vehicle is parked in the open air or refrigerated environment for several weeks, the battery should be taken out and stored in a warmer room to prevent the battery from freezing and damaging.

Five, check the fuse box.
Clean, check and replace the hidden fuse in time, keep the fuse box clean, and avoid failure due to fuse problems in dark winter.
Six, check and replace the glass water in winter.
In the environment below 0℃ in winter, antifreeze winter glass water should be replaced, and tap water cannot be used. Because once the temperature is too low, substitutes such as pure water and tap water often freeze, and sometimes the container is broken, so in winter, the original substitutes such as pure water must be taken out and replaced with glass cleaning liquid that is not afraid of freezing. Seven, check the rubber wiper blade.
When the temperature is low in winter, the aging rubber wiper blade becomes stiff and cannot be used. It is better to replace it to ensure safety.
Eight, check the front and rear lights and bulbs.
Checking and replacing black bulbs in advance can reduce the number of bulb replacement in winter. Nine, keep the thermostat working normally.
The thermostat is used to automatically control the normal water temperature of the engine. When the engine is started at a low temperature, it can quickly heat up the engine and reduce cylinder wear. Some cars have high water temperature in summer, so the repair union removed the thermostat. Although summer can solve the problem, it is the other way around in winter. If you are not careful, you may waste a bucket of antifreeze for a small water pipe.
The test shows that if the thermostat is removed, the engine start-up heating time will be extended by 4 to 5 times, and the cylinder wear will increase by 5 to 6 times. Therefore, it is incorrect to disassemble the thermostat at will.
